City of Monterey

• The Monterey City Council will hold a study session on Wednesday, March 26 at 4:00 PM to discuss a Draft 2025 Economic Development Strategy and direct staff on how to complete and implement the strategy. See the staff report at Receive Draft 2025 Economic Development Strategy and Provide Feedback on Economic Development Roadmap

  • According to City Manager Hans Uslar, the City of Monterey notices “the competition is not sleeping” and the city must therefore “remain at forefront of developments” in the economy if it wants to "attract new business and bring existing businesses up to today's standards”
  • One of the city’s nine designated "Economic Drivers” to achieve its vision and mission is Fiscal Stewardship, which includes sound economic vitality efforts, vision long-term planning, and community partnerships
  • Although some residents seem to regard local commerce as something generally detrimental to their quality of life, the City of Monterey recognizes that business prosperity and growth is essential to providing tax revenue to pay for services expected and demanded by its residents

Healthcare

Montage Health reports its involvement in the Monterey County Health Needs Collaborative, a partnership of hospitals, health organizations, and community agencies working together to improve the health and well-being of Monterey County residents through projects such as the Community Health Needs Assessment

The collaborative was formed in 2022 among the four hospital systems in Monterey County (Mee Memorial Healthcare System, Montage Health, Natividad, and Salinas Valley Health), along with the County of Monterey Health Department and United Way Monterey County. It now also includes California State University Monterey Bay (CSUMB), and Central California Alliance for Health

Moss Landing Vistra Power Plant Fire

The Monterey County Farm Bureau reports that new soil tests conducted by the University of California Cooperative Agricultural Extension program have confirmed earlier reports that the Moss Landing Vistra Power Plant Fire has not compromised health or safety of any field workers or agricultural products near the battery storage facility. See Evaluation of Heavy Metals in Agricultural Fields Following the Moss Landing Battery Fire

• There were no crops planted or growing in the nearby fields, as the fire occurred in mid-January

The so-called toxic "heavy metals” such as cobalt, copper, manganese, and nickel are already naturally present in soil and serve as micronutrients for plant metabolism, growth, and development

Rumors to the contrary that circulate on social media and get highlighted by trial lawyers are unsubstantiated and irresponsible. Transportation

The intersection of Carmel Valley Road and Laureles Grade, five miles north of Carmel Valley Village, will soon be converted from the existing stop-controlled intersection to a roundabout. Bids for this project were opened on March 20 and the Board of Supervisors will soon consider awarding a contract

The updates are meant to improve traffic flow, reduce serious collisions, and make the intersection safer for pedestrian use

Friends of Laguna Seca Names Motorsports Veteran Mel Harder General Manager of WeatherTech Raceway Laguna Seca


Friends of Laguna Seca announced that Mel Harder has been named President and General Manager of WeatherTech Raceway Laguna Seca.

 

Harder brings three decades of motorsports experience to his new role after most recently serving as team manager at Chip Ganassi Racing. His previous positions include senior vice president and general manager of Circuit of the Americas and senior vice president of the Indianapolis Motor Speedway. Harder’s experience provides him with an extensive background in hosting international, world-class events and facility management.

 

“Our board and team are very enthusiastic about having Mel join us and his background makes him uniquely qualified to strengthen our efforts at WeatherTech Raceway and Laguna Seca Recreation Area,” said Lauri Eberhart, CEO of Friends of Laguna Seca. “His insight and operational expertise will play a pivotal role in facilitating our long-term commitment to the local and motorsports communities, our partners and dedicated fans, and our efforts to revitalize Laguna Seca for generations to come.”

 

In his new role, Harder will collaborate closely with Eberhart and the entire raceway team to implement Friends’ business model designed to enhance operational performance and develop new experiences and services for guests, motorsports series, and partners.
